#RC#
A generic revert signal usually hides a more specific logic conflict within the contract code. The program-examples interface might occasionally display a “nonce error” . Increasing your slippage tolerance to a more flexible range can bypass the execution revert.
Check if the asset you are moving has a whitelist requirement that . To optimize program-examples for mobile use, ensure you are using a compatible Web3 browser. Testing the fix on a dev-fork like Ganache is the best way to ensure safety.
An outdated provider library is often the root cause of many failed dApp interactions. The error could also be the result of an incompatibility with the latest RPC standard. A mismatch between the expected gas and the actual required gas can lead to a revert.